Home
last modified time | relevance | path

Searched refs:devsw_lock (Results 1 – 4 of 4) sorted by relevance

/xnu-12377.61.12/bsd/kern/
H A Dbsd_stubs.c52 typedef struct devsw_lock { struct
53 TAILQ_ENTRY(devsw_lock) dl_list;
62 static TAILQ_HEAD(, devsw_lock) devsw_locks = TAILQ_HEAD_INITIALIZER(devsw_locks); argument
349 devsw_lock(dev_t dev, int mode) in devsw_lock() function
356 newlock = kalloc_type(struct devsw_lock, Z_WAITOK | Z_ZERO); in devsw_lock()
379 kfree_type(struct devsw_lock, newlock); in devsw_lock()
413 kfree_type(struct devsw_lock, lock); in devsw_unlock()
H A Dtty_tty.c117 devsw_lock(dev, S_IFCHR); in cttyopen()
145 devsw_lock(dev, S_IFCHR); in cttyopen()
/xnu-12377.61.12/bsd/sys/
H A Dconf.h301 extern void devsw_lock(dev_t, int);
/xnu-12377.61.12/bsd/miscfs/specfs/
H A Dspec_vnops.c400 devsw_lock(dev, S_IFCHR); in spec_open()
462 devsw_lock(dev, S_IFBLK); in spec_open()
883 devsw_lock(dev, S_IFCHR); in spec_ioctl()
2864 devsw_lock(dev, S_IFCHR); in spec_close_internal()
2879 devsw_lock(dev, S_IFCHR); in spec_close_internal()
2914 devsw_lock(dev, S_IFBLK); in spec_close_internal()
2936 devsw_lock(dev, S_IFBLK); in spec_close_internal()